What is a Giant Pay Weekly job?

A Giant Pay Weekly job refers to a position where employees, often temporary, contract, or agency workers, are paid on a weekly basis through Giant, a payroll and umbrella company. This arrangement is popular among contractors and freelancers in industries like construction, healthcare, and IT, as it offers more frequent access to earnings compared to traditional monthly pay. Giant handles all payroll administration, ensuring that workers receive their pay after taxes, National Insurance, and other deductions. This setup can also include statutory benefits and support with tax compliance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a payroll spec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Payroll Specialist, you need strong numerical skills, attention to detail, and a solid understanding of payroll regulations, typically supported by relevant experience or a degree in accounting or finance. Familiarity with payroll software such as ADP, QuickBooks, or Sage, and certifications like the Fundamental Payroll Certification (FPC) are often required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and discretion with sensitive information are critical soft skills for this role. These skills ensure accurate and timely payroll processing, compliance with legal requirements, and effective communication with employees and management.

POSITION SUMMARY

Responsible for meat operation including but not limited to preparing, storing, cutting, cleaning, and serving meat.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  • Monitor food Distribution and ensure that guidelines are followed.
  • Clean and sterilize dishes, kitchen utensils, equipment, and facilities.
  • Maintain coolers, cases and displays by keeping them stocked.

Observe scheduled shift hours as assigned by meat and/or store manager.

  • Give all customers friendly, courteous, and prompt service.
  • Maintain good communication with the meat manager.

Share responsibility for controlling shrink.

Properly record all hours worked. Verify and sign the time ticket report.

Monitor food preparation and serving.

Responsible for assisting in recording and maintaining accurate bookkeeping systems as far as weekly meat purchases and monthly meat purchases.

Assist in maintaining proper record to control shrink through inventory and ordering.

Responsible for assisting in inventorying all products on hand before prepaying a meat order.

Assist Meat Manager in taking a four-week period meat inventory.

Ensure that product is being rotated when received and stocked.

Ensure that all meat coolers and meat cases are running at the proper temperature.

Ensure that proper safety procedures are being used.

Properly clean and maintain meat department, coolers, cases and equipment.
